TV Official: Kim Fields Joins "Real Housewives of Atlanta"

"Real Housewives of Atlanta" Starts Filming with Transgender Model Amiyah Scott and Kim Fields (Tootie!)
by Kristin Dos Santos
8/18/15



Things are heating up again in Hotlanta!

On the heels of the news that "Real Housewives of Atlanta" star NeNe Leakes is moving on to other projects, Bravo is spicing up its high-rated series with two additions: Amiyah Scott and Kim Fields, E! News has confirmed.



Scott is a transgender model (born as Arthur and raised in New Orleans) and although she hasn't been offered a series regular role as a Housewife, she began filming with RHOA crews last night for the show's eighth season.

"Amiya is a friend of Kenya's," a source tells E! News exclusively, "and she was at an event that Kenya threw last night. So she filmed last night. Other than that, she's having conversations with production. Talks are happening but it's too soon to say what will come of it."



Fields, who got her start in Hollywood as Tootie on "The Facts of Life", has been named a Housewife and the plan is to have her very much a part of the new season. However, a source adds, "Anything can happen."

Last night was the first time the RHOA ladies filmed with Fields, and we are told that there was no drama — just introductory pleasantries.



Bravo had no comment on the casting news.

Why Kim Fields Finally Said Yes to Joining "Real Housewives of Atlanta"
by Jean Bentley
11/8/15



Kim Fields and her family have been approached many times by reality TV producers eager to have the actress on their shows — but the newest "Real Housewives of Atlanta" cast member took a while to finally say yes.

"We've been asked to do reality TV for years, and it just wasn't the right timing, right opportunity," she tells E! News of her new gig.



But somehow, the stars finally aligned and she agreed to join the RHoA cast.

"It's such an adventure. It's something different," the "Facts of Life" and "Living Single" star says of finally taking the leap. "If you're going to look up and celebrate 40 years of doing something, at this point, for me at least, the next logical progression is what's challenging? What's new? What's different?"







Although Fields didn't have any preconceived notions as far as what to expect, she made sure to do her research and due diligence before walking into situations that can get extremely volatile at times (to say the least!).

"I don't think it's fair to go into any environment armed with, 'Oh, this is already going to be this.' Just go in with an open mind, an open heart," she dishes. "Now, go in with wisdom so you don't get your head knocked off as soon as you hit the door!"



Fields, who will appear alongside her husband and two children on the show, says her biggest concern before taking the leap was the effect on her family and friends.

"I'm very, very, very protective of my family, of my marriage, of my parenting."







And don't worry, she trusts the audience to know what fights are real and what's being blown out of proportion.

"Audiences are so smart now. They know what is puffed-up fodder that is dredged up just for the purposes of being mean-spirited. They know what's real. They certainly know me, and to be able to pull back another layer...has been exciting."


Fields makes her "Real Housewives of Atlanta" debut on Sunday, Nov. 8 at 8 p.m. on Bravo.
